I think, without daclaration of the exact origin it´s not possible to determine our Ancistrus. Really big for a "common" Ancistrus cf dolichopterus (but maybe, Marion has also a common Ancistrus with 18cm). L-43 reaches f.e. a total lenght > 20cm |
Hi Walter,
I find only this one page -Ancistrus spp. ""Bussy Pleco", where is Ancistrus similar to female on my picture. But on other pages is L156 about 10-12 cm only. :( L43 is 20-25 cm, Ancistrus dolichopterus - import from nature - 20 cm and Ancistrus "punctatus" about 25-30 cm, but they are black with little white spots. Origin of female on my picture is not known. |
